Text

Any dealer, broker, livestock market operator, or other person subject to this article who violates any provision of this article, any quarantine provision, or any rule or regulation established by the Commissioner under the authority of this or other laws for the protection of the general public in the prevention of equine diseases shall be guilty of a misdemeanor.
